Dunbar Education invites passionate and dedicated SEND Teaching Assistants to embark on an enriching journey in the vibrant schools of Shropshire. As a vital member of our team, you'll play a pivotal role in nurturing and supporting students with special educational needs and disabilities, empowering them to thrive academically and personally.

Why Choose Dunbar Education?

  • Empowerment: Make a real difference in the lives of children and young people, providing tailored support to meet their unique needs.
  • Professional Growth: Access to continuous training and development opportunities to enhance your skills and advance your career in education.
  • Collaborative Environment: Join a supportive community of educators and specialists, fostering collaboration and sharing best practices.
  • Variety: Experience diverse learning environments across Shropshire, gaining invaluable insights and broadening your expertise.
  • Rewarding Work: Experience the joy of seeing your efforts positively impact the lives of students, families, and communities.

Requirements:

  • Experience or qualifications in supporting children with SEND (Special Educational Needs and Disabilities).
  • A compassionate and patient demeanor, with a genuine passion for working with children.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, fostering positive relationships with students, colleagues, and parents.
